      Description
      OverviewRecombinant, human COCO consisting of amino acids 23-189 and expressed in E. coli with an N-terminal methionine. Inhibits BMP-4 induced activity in MC3T3-E1 mouse osteoblastic cells. ED 50 = 0.15-0.75 µg/ml. Human COCO, at the amino acid sequence level, is 60% and 24% identical with mouse and Xenopus COCO, respectively.

      Storage and Shipping Information
      Ship Code Ambient Temperature Only
      Toxicity Standard Handling
      Storage -20°C
      Do not freeze Ok to freeze
      Special InstructionsFollowing reconstitution refrigerate (4°C) for short-term storage or aliquot and freeze (-20°C) for long-term storage. Stock solutions are stable for up to 1 month at 4°C or for up to 3 months at -20°C.
